9:10 AM - 9:50 AM (CDT)

This opening keynote sets the foundation for this year’s event, examining how AI is altering marketing and commerce across discovery, media, personalization and measurement. As enterprise systems become increasingly automated, traditional frameworks no longer apply. This session will offer clarity on where disruption is already happening, why old models are breaking down, and what new approaches are emerging for a commerce landscape being rewritten in real time.

2:25 PM - 2:55 PM (CDT)

As technology reshapes how people discover, evaluate and buy, the balance of power between brands and consumers is shifting. Again. This session will confront the biggest assumptions shaping sales and marketing strategy today. Two senior executives will take positions on statements like:

  • Consumers now trust algorithms more than brands
  • Convenience will always outweigh privacy concerns
  • Loyalty is driven more by experience than price
  • Automation can replace retail execution field teams

The audience will vote fact or fiction in real time, revealing clarity around what’s changing in consumer behavior, and what it means for go-to-market strategy.

3:55 PM - 4:25 PM (CDT)

Revenue growth management is undergoing a fundamental transformation as AI-enabled platforms sub in for periodic analysis and human judgement. This session will explore how RGM is evolving from a set of tactical levers into an enterprise system of intelligence. Speakers will discuss how organizations are embedding AI into revenue decisions, what this means for cross-functional alignment between sales, marketing and finance, and how leaders can maintain strategic control in an increasingly automated environment.

2:25 PM - 2:50 PM (CDT)

Two sides. No slides. Senior leaders take positions on statements like:

  • AI will automate trade promotion decisions better than sales and marketing teams
  • Pricing and assortment strategies will be set by algorithms, not revenue leaders
  • In-store execution will be managed by predictive systems rather than field teams
  • Interoperability will matter more than individual platform performance
  • Future CMOs will be closer to CTOs than creative directors

Each statement is debated live, and the audience will weigh in with their fact or fiction votes in real time.
